The Role of Electronics Manufacturing in Recording Studios: Recording studios are at the heart of music production, and electronics play a crucial role in capturing the essence of musical creativity. From high-quality microphones and preamps to state-of-the-art mixing consoles and digital audio workstations, electronics manufacturing has transformed the recording process. The clarity and precision brought by advanced equipment allow artists to produce professional-grade tracks that effectively convey their intended emotions and experiences. 2. Lyric Writing in the Digital Age: With the advent of technology, lyric writing has evolved to encompass various electronic tools and platforms. Songwriters now have access to digital notepads, voice memo apps, and software specifically designed for lyric creation. These advancements empower artists to jot down their inspirations on-the-go and collaborate with other musicians seamlessly. The abundance of electronic resources has made lyric writing more efficient and versatile. 3. Digital Platforms and Music Distribution: The rise of digital platforms has revolutionized music distribution and consumption. Companies like Spotify, Apple Music, and YouTube provide artists with a global stage to showcase their talent, thanks to electronics manufacturing. Streaming services have become a gateway for aspiring artists to reach wider audiences and monetize their music. Electronic devices like smartphones, tablets, and smart speakers have made accessing music easier and more convenient for listeners worldwide. 4. Innovative Music Interfaces: Electronics manufacturing has also given birth to innovative music interfaces that bridge the gap between musicians and their instruments. MIDI controllers, electronic drum kits, and synthesizers have empowered artists to experiment with new sounds and create unique musical experiences. These futuristic interfaces allow performers to manipulate the sound in real-time, enabling live performances that push the boundaries of traditional music. 5. Enhanced Audio Quality and Audio Effects: Advancements in electronics manufacturing have significantly improved the audio quality and the availability of audio effects in music production. From guitar pedals to vocal processors, artists can leverage an array of tools to enhance their musical creations. Electronics have made it possible to achieve various soundscapes and creative effects that were once difficult to implement without the aid of extensive recording equipment.
